Job Summary Performs highly advanced business analysis work. Work involves overseeing the gathering, development, and documentation of user requirements; the review, assessment, and development of business processes; the creation and validation of user acceptance testing; the performance of post implementation support of systems; support of the systems development life cycle; and supervising the work of others. Works under minimal supervision with extensive latitude for the use of initiative and independent judgment.
Essential Functions
Oversees the analysis and testing of procedures and information systems for efficiency and effectiveness; oversees, assesses, and reviews user requirements, procedures, and problems to automate and improve existing systems; coordinates and analyzes computer system capabilities, workflow, and scheduling limitations; and participates in user acceptance testing and testing of new system functionality.
Oversees the development and review of complex system documents to convey business requirements and support efficient system design; oversees the preparation of charts, diagrams, tables, flowcharts, and other technical documentation regarding information technology systems and computer applications; and prepares reports outlining study findings and recommendations following the Systems Development Life Cycle (SDLC) methodology.
Oversees the analysis of program policies and procedures to determine their effect on automated systems and system functional areas; oversees the service request life cycle through customer-related service request responses, business requirements coordination across program areas, business requirements elicitation from requesters, technical specifications and related artifacts review, and monitors system integration and user acceptance testing prior to implementation; and confers with management regarding the status and progress of studies and projects being conducted.
Oversees the development, documentation, and revision of system design procedures, test procedures, and quality standards; provides technical assistance in the design, development, implementation, and modification of new and existing systems; and coordinates the development of online help systems, operational manuals, educational materials, technical training, and information programs for automated systems.
Supervises the work of others.
Performs a variety of marginal duties not listed, to be determined and assigned as needed.
Minimum Qualifications Education, Experience, and Training
Graduation from an accredited senior high school or equivalent or GED and eight years full time, wage-earning experience in at least two of the following functions: information systems analysis, business process analysis, planning, documenting requirements, designing, testing, software or systems quality assurance engineering, or deployment.
sixty semester hours from a college or university accredited by an organization recognized by the Council for Higher Education Accreditation (CHEA) or by the United States Department of Education (USDE) with twelve semester hours in Management Information Systems, Information Technology, or a related field and six years full-time, wage-earning experience in at least two of the following functions: information systems analysis, business process analysis, planning, documenting requirements, designing, testing, software or systems quality assurance engineering, or deployment.
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Business, or a related field from a college or university accredited by an organization recognized by the Council for Higher Education Accreditation (CHEA) or by the United States Department of education (USDE) and six years full-time, wage-earning experience in at least two of the following functions: information systems analysis, business process analysis, planning, documenting requirements, designing, testing, software or systems quality assurance engineering, or deployment.
Four years full-time, wage-earning project management or project coordination experience.
Three years full-time, wage-earning experience in the supervision of employees.
